WebA sound wall is an organized display of the sounds (phonemes) and their matching letters (graphemes) that we use in our language. While there are 26 letters in our alphabet, we use many different combinations of letters to write down (i.e. represent) the sounds in our speech. WebMar 11, 2024 · What is a Sound Wall? A sound wall is a tool used within the classroom where all 44 sounds in the English language are displayed. This includes both consonant and vowel sounds.. Sound walls are organized in two parts: a Consonant Sound Wall and a Vowel Valley. In both places, every sound should include: Mouth articulation pictures.
